The opportunity

We are looking for a Senior Consultant to join our Infrastructure Advisory team in our Lisbon office. EY’s Infrastructure Advisory practice is a leading advisor to public and private sector clients on commercial, economic, regulatory, policy, financial and transaction advisory services. EY advises and assists its clients to carry out their transaction plans (buy-side or sell side transactions), as well as their fund-raising activities. Our EY Infrastructure Advisory group has an established track record of advising both public and private sectors on infrastructure projects worldwide. Our core team has a broad and deep understanding of infrastructure demonstrated by our strong credentials covering a range of industry sectors (transports, power, water and environment, and social infrastructure such as hospitals and universities).


Your key responsibilities

  • Provide strategic, economic, financial, commercial, regulatory and policy advice to inform our clients’ decision making;
- Develop and/or analyze financial model using various valuation approaches and methods to support clients' various purposes including, but not - limited to, feasibility study, financial projection review, business plan development, project transaction and structuring, joint ventures economics, and project finance transactions;
  • Participate in engagements, project teams and high quality client deliverables;
  • Support the development of junior staff including by playing a strong role in mentoring and providing pragmatic feedback, both constructive and supportive;
  • Collaborate with people across Strategy and Transactions, as well as the broader EY team to support service delivery outcomes and cross-teaming;
  • Be proactive and present – positively contribute to culture, participate in learning and training opportunities and foster inclusive teaming.

To qualify for the role, you must have

  • Degree in Finance, Business or Economics from a reputable university;
  • 3 to 4 years of related working experience, including in Public Sector, State-Owned Enterprise, Management Consulting, Big-4 firms, Financial Institution, and/or Investment House;
  • Knowledge and relationships in one or more of the following sectors: Transport, Power and Utilities, Water and Environment, Social Infrastructure;
  • A strong interest in infrastructure;
  • Experience in the development of projects and support to transactions (M&A) of transports, energy and utilities, social infrastructure, Public Private Partnerships (PPPs) and/or Project Finance;
  • Project finance including financial modelling development and analysis is mandatory.
